Campsites on the East Coast of England

England's east coast is not to be underestimated with its rich history, seaside resorts and pretty nature reserves. The sandy beaches around Southend-on-Sea are superb family spots for catching some sun while the Norfolk Broads are great for coastal walks where you may even spot a seal or two. Campsites on the east coast of England place you near popular resorts such as Skegness or quieter retreats like Cromer.
